Core1.aeThis is a programmable sound generator from Wonkystuff. The Core series are small, reprogrammable devices, based around a particularly limited microprocessor (as used by Bastl in their Kastle) having a mere 8kB of code space and 512 bytes of RAM! We find that with these limitations, some interesting algorithms can still be programmed and new and interesting sound generators and modulators can be constructed. It comes with dr1 firmware already loaded to be a complex oscillator. Inputs As per the normal operation of the core1.ae the inputs for b, c, d can be used to CV control the parameters which are otherwise controlled by the corresponding knobs. The knob position provides an offset to which the input CV is added. How to program the Core1.ae moduleThis is very old school in that you load new programs in to the module via the audio input.
